  • Bio

    “Even Dylan would love this,” said View Magazine about music from Leslie Alexander, who grew up on an Alberta sheep farm & couldn't wait to hit the road, make a bunch of mistakes & write songs about them. She wound up singing on a street corner for spare change & does not consider this a mistake. Since then, Leslie’s toured across North America, sharing concert and festival stages with her own band or opening for the likes of Jane Siberry, Barney Bentall, Mary Gauthier and many others. Three independent CD releases have garnered critical acclaim, international airplay and honorable mentions from the ISC and Billboard Song Competitions, as well as cuts with other artists & licenses for television & film. Joining forces with performing songwriter Jenny Allen, Leslie workshopped material for her fourth studio release as one half of the new duo “Allen & Alexander” on their “Love’m or Leave’em Tour 2010.” Sharing vocals, multiple instruments and much in common with her fellow native Albertan, Leslie is rapidly filling her calendar as the pair travel “clean across Canada” on their upcoming “Dirty Laundry Dual CD Release Tour 2011.” “The music & material go hand in hand to create a landscape that's familiar, yet filled with so much to explore," said the Calgary Sun about Leslie’s second record “Savage Country.” Today, Leslie is still exploring, but the landscape of “Nobody’s Baby” is internal, as well as evocative of new horizons. Along with BCCMA Producer of the Year John Ellis (Be Good Tanyas, Jane Siberry) Alexander covers territory between the personal and universal with ten startlingly original tunes that haunt the listener like déjà vu. On disc or onstage, tracing influences from Tin Pan Alley to swamp rock, from hootenanny to honky-tonk, Leslie’s songs about old flames and fresh blood will take you all the beautiful and terrifying places she’s been.
